The decorated car was something I’ll never forget.  Yes, it was a beautiful silver Toyota Cruiser that was absolutely plastered beyond recognition.  The bride dropped her jaw in disbelief when she finally could see it after the sparklers.  The good part was that the friends and family had first wrapped the car first in plastic, and then decorated with syrups, cream, cherries, strawberries.  If the food was at the party, it was on the car.  The couple simply had to cut the plastic off the car and it all fell to the ground and they drove away.

Outside Balcony view at wedding venue in UtahThere is still a great secret out there about wedding reception centers in Utah.  People are still discovering the gem called Ivy House Weddings at Western Gardens Downtown.  After one year of being in business, Ivy House Weddings is continuing to surprise celebration guests.  So many people recognize the address as belonging to Western Gardens retail garden store, but they are pleasantly surprised that the wedding reception they are attending, is right there too!  Ivy House is a part of Western Gardens but guests enjoy their own beautiful entrance and separate elegant space.  The chandeliers and majestic fireplace create that touch of sophistication with a dose of elegance.
